We made a silly mistake last week but we've fixed it, and we also had to reverse our own logic; let's dive into it.
We dropped Fresno State down below Cal Maritime last week. That was a dumb error—Fresno State had already beaten the Keehaulers. We just over-reacted to a big loss by Fresno, which is something we at GRR World Headquarters have to keep an eye on.
This week saw most teams in D1A put together results that were, in general, expected.
University of San Diego did about as much as you'd hope for a #1 to stay #1, winning in convincing fashion over a Fresno State team that we had at #12.
While we don't have a ton of changes at the top of the D1A rankings, we do have a change at #1.
Cal moves up to #1 after a shutout win over Arizona. Remember, Arizona held Saint Mary's to a 12-10 Gael victory, and we're thinking that if you factor that in with a 24-22 Life win over Saint Mary's, and the fact that Life also beat Navy, we kind of have to make the move.
